Frequently Asked Questions
What are some of the newest Las Vegas resorts currently under construction?
Among the newest Las Vegas resorts under construction is Cadence Crossing, a Boyd Gaming project in Henderson expected to open in mid-2026. Another exciting addition is The Vanderpump, transforming the Cromwell on the Las Vegas Strip into a unique destination partnered with celebrity Lisa Vanderpump.
What changes can we expect at The Vanderpump Las Vegas at the Cromwell?
The Vanderpump Las Vegas, which is currently transforming the Cromwell, will feature upgraded guest rooms and suites along with a revamped casino floor. This major renovation, anticipated to be completed in early 2026, aims to enhance the overall guest experience on the Las Vegas Strip.
Are there any upcoming casinos in Las Vegas that I should know about?
Yes! Cadence Crossing is an upcoming casino being built in Henderson, aiming to provide a 10,000 square foot gaming area and a variety of dining options. This project marks Boyd Gaming’s first new casino in years.
What can you tell me about the Rolling Stone hotel in Las Vegas?
The Rolling Stone hotel in Las Vegas is in the planning stages, with Penske Media looking to acquire the Downtown Grand to launch a Rolling Stone branded hotel and casino. This aligns with their aim to expand the brand’s presence in Las Vegas.
What updates do we have about the transition of the Mirage to the Hard Rock Hotel Las Vegas?
The transformation of the Mirage into the new Hard Rock Hotel Las Vegas is progressing well. The new guitar-shaped hotel is being constructed with over 3,000 rooms and a vast casino floor. This new resort is set to open in early 2027 as a major addition to the Las Vegas Strip.
Is the Dream Hotel project still happening on the Las Vegas Strip?
Yes, the Dream Hotel project located at the south end of the Las Vegas Strip is still under construction, but its developers have requested a two-year extension on building permits, indicating that there might be delays in its completion.
How does the transformation of existing hotels in Las Vegas affect tourism?
The transformation of existing hotels, like the Cromwell into The Vanderpump and the Mirage into the Hard Rock, helps to rejuvenate the Las Vegas Strip, attracting more visitors. These changes cater to evolving tourist preferences and enhance the overall entertainment offerings in Las Vegas.
Resort Name | Location | Status | Key Features | Expected Completion |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
The Vanderpump | Las Vegas Strip | Renovating | 188 renovated guest rooms, rebranding of Cromwell’s casino floor | Early 2026 | |
Cadence Crossing | Henderson | Under Construction | 10,000 sq ft casino, 450 slot machines, future hotel tower | Mid-2024 | |
Rolling Stone Hotel & Casino | Downtown Las Vegas | Proposed Acquisition | Brand expansion by Penske Media, potential home for Life is Beautiful festival | TBD | |
Hard Rock Las Vegas (formerly Mirage) | Las Vegas Strip | Under Renovation | Guitar-shaped hotel, 2000 slot machines, 3000+ rooms | Early 2027 | |
Dream Hotel | Las Vegas Boulevard | Delayed Construction | Currently unplanned, permit extension requested | TBD |
